Replace the glass-insulated unit (IGU).

Insulated glass makes it easy to keep your home warm during winter and cool in summer. Insulated glass can reduce the loss of heat and reduces your air conditioning costs. In addition, it can increase the value of your home. There are a variety of options to meet your needs whether you need new windows or want to repair the ones you have.


Insulated glass is used to prevent condensation from forming inside your home. It has multiple panes , separated by the spacer. Spacers can be constructed from structural foam or made of metal. They can be manufactured to order and can be purchased in a variety of sizes and thicknesses.

The life of an insulated glass unit (IGU) is dependent on the conditions in which it is placed and the quality of the materials employed. IGUs generally last between 10 and 20 years. It is dependent on the distance between the inner and the outer panes. The amount of sunlight, temperature variations and the type of glazing sealant can all contribute to the failure of an IGU.

You'll need to replace your window that is insulated when it is damaged. It is not advised to attempt a DIY project as it might be difficult to identify the cause of the damage. Professional help will also ensure the most effective results.

Reduce heat loss through window space

To maximize your home's energy efficiency It is crucial to limit the loss of heat through windows. There are many ways to do this. There are three variables that influence the flow of heat through your windows. They are the frame material, the U-factor , and the glazing component. Each component contributes to the energy consumption of your home in a different way.

The U-factor is a measurement of the extent to which a window reflects and absorbs heat from the sun. It is possible to reduce the U-factor of your windows, which can impact the efficiency of your home's cools and heats.

The U-factor of windows can be reduced using materials with low conductivity and special gases. These include argon and krypton and other low conductivity materials. The thermal conductivity of these gases is considerably less than air, which means they can substitute air to increase the performance of your windows' thermal efficiency.

You can alter the glazing component of your window to enhance the heat transfer. You can do this by applying a coating of low-emittance to the glass's surface. If the exterior surface of the glass is consistent from top to bottom, the U-value of the unit will be less. To minimize heat transfer through the glazing you can utilize multiple layers of glass.

Shades or curtains can also be used to reduce heat loss. These shades help keep the heat inside your home and block heat from the windows during daylight hours. These are especially useful in winter, when temperatures are low. They can also be used for preventing condensation from the windows.
